Blues Hog BBQ: 2025 Reserve Grand Champion – Whole Hog
A well-deserved congratulations go out to Blues Hog BBQ who was named Reserve Grand Champion in the Whole Hog Category! Not only that, Blues Hog's accomplishments at this year's World Championship Barbecue Cooking Contest also include winning 2nd Place in the Poultry Category and 3rd Place in the Exotics Category.
Blues Hog BBQ is a Missouri-based competitive BBQ team that has won over 35 Grand Champion titles and over 40 Reserve Grand Championship titles. Led up by Head Pitmaster Tim Scheer, Blues Hog previously won top honors as the Overall World Champion and Whole Hog World Champion at the World Championship Barbecue Cooking Contest in 2022.

Kaiden Blake Outdoor Kitchen: 2025 Junior Grand Champion – Chicken Category & Pork Category
The winning ways of ThermoPro’s sponsored teams don’t stop there! Kaiden Blake Outdoor Kitchen became a two-time champ at the international BBQ competition, winning 2025 Junior Grand Champion for both the Chicken Category and the Pork Category. What’s more, if we were to include the Smoke Slam BBQ competition happening nearby at the same time over at Memphis in May, Kaiden won multiple awards that include 4th Place in Chicken, 2nd Place in Ribs, and 2nd Place in Pork.
Kaiden Blake is a 15-year-old BBQ prodigy from Wellings, OK, who has been turning heads with his inspirational story. Blake started cooking BBQ by watching YouTube videos after he wasn’t able to play sports anymore. Currently taking part in BBQ competitions across the country, Blake’s dream is to visit children’s hospitals to teach children how to barbecue.

Ribdiculous–Bar–B–Krewe: 4th Place – Shoulder Category
Ribdiculous–Bar–B–Krewe showed off their impeccable BBQ skills by placing fourth in the WCBCC’s Shoulder category.
Founded in 2008 by Head Pitmaster Shane McBride, Ribdiculous Bar-B-Krewe catapulted to success a year later by winning first place for Hot Wings in the 2009 World Championship Barbecue Cooking Contest. Fourteen years later at the same renowned competition, the team achieved its highest honor by being named Grand Champion and Ribs Champion in 2023.

Willingham’s BBQ: 4th Place – Poultry Category
Willingham’s BBQ added yet another trophy to their long list of accomplishments by taking fourth place in the Poultry category.
The Memphis-based Willingham’s World Champion BBQ first won the World Championship Barbecue Cooking Contest under John Willingham in 1983 & 1984. Currently led by Paul Holden, the team has continued to win throughout its 44 years of competing at WCBCC, having recently won the Turkey Smoke category in 2024 and receiving 4th Place in Poultry the same year.

Bubba Grills: Green Grilling Award Winner; Kingsford Tour of Champions – 3rd Place
Bubba Grills was recognized on several fronts by the competition. Not only was Bubba Grills named the winner of this year’s Green Grilling Award, but it also received third place in the Kingsford Tour of Champions.
Based out of Haddock, Georgia, Bubba Grills is a competitive BBQ team led by Lonnie Smith that has won 6 times at the World Championship Barbecue Cooking Contest. Just last year, Bubba Grills took second place for the Whole Hog category and was named the Kingsford Tour Of Champions winner at this world-famous BBQ competition.
